Since the beginning of time, the angelic forces of the High Heavens and the demonic hordes of the Burning Hells have been locked in the Eternal Conflict for the fate of all Creation. That struggle has now spilled over into Sanctuary -- the world of men. Determined to win mankind over to their respective causes, the forces of good and evil wage a secret war for mortal souls. This is the tale of the Sin War -- the conflict that would forever change the destiny of man.

Bent on destroying the evil cult of the Triune, Uldyssian does not yet suspect that Inarius -- secret Prophet of the Cathedral of Light -- has been subtly aiding his quest. Obsessed with restoring Sanctuary to its former glory, Inarius has been playing Uldyssian against the two great religions in a reckless attempt to topple them both. But another player has slipped back into the equation. The demon Lilith, once Inarius's lover, seeks to use Uldyssian as her own pawn in a scheme to turn humans into an army of naphalem -- godlike beings, more powerful than any angel or demon, who could overturn all Creation and elevate Lilith to supreme being.

An original tale of swords, sorcery, and timeless struggle based on the bestselling, award-winning M-rated computer game fromBlizzard Entertainment. Intended for mature readers.

This book is a good one to become proficient at this classic role-playing game. It's key info is needed to quickly defeat Diablo. I wrote this review after winning Diablo as all three characters; swordsman, archer, and sage, over 6 months as a single player. Diablo won the 1996 game-of-the-year by the computer mags and is phenomenal game that one grows to appreciate its complexity as you get better.

In a nutshell, Diablo is a first person shoot-em-up game against 19 classes of enemies. Diablo stays interesting as the 16-playfield layouts change for each game and the 1000s of creatures have a complex variation of personalities, strengths, and weaknesses. The first 4 levels have sprawling layouts of Dungeon rooms; levels 5-8 have Catacombs which are smaller layouts of rough rock walls; levels 9-12 are Caves with large excavations and meandering streams; and the final 13-16 Hell levels are laid out as interstitial quadrangles. The game play is a nice blend between isometric 3D visualizations, character animations and sounds, and multimedia video clips.

With this book, playing success is an exercise in developing strong Diablo problem-solving skills. Initially looking on the Internet for Diablo cheatz which were few as its a legacy 6-year old game. What this book provides is info and strategy that can help you defeat the myriad of creatures and quests. My book has become a much thumbed, reread, indexed, and enhanced with scrawled notes on how to defeat them.

For example, I found that the easiest character to win was the Rogue archer-woman and won Diablo in 3 games, as archery is a distance scenario. The next easiest character to win was the Warrior swordsman, completed in 5 games, mainly because of hand-to-hand combat experience as a kid. The most difficult character, of course, was the sage Sorcerer, which took me 9 games to win because of the myriad (26) magic potions that need to be mastered. This book gives you an informal discussion and tables of characteristics without all the trial and error. Although it discusses general tactics, it is weak in overall game strategy and specific tactics on specific minions.

This book provides details on the power of weapons and armor and strength and weaknesses of enemies. It also covers the 17 special Quests quite well. The author writes in an entertaining prose and presents key info is in complex tables. I found that Blizzard's production release of Diablo v1.04 and internet update download to v1.08 was very stable and reliable on a P5/233MMX, Socket7 PCI mobo TX chipset, ATI Rage PCI video, 64MB RAM, 52X CD, 10GB HD, and SB16 running Win98SE.

The book is divided into 10 chapters including the making of, but has no index or glossary, which is a serious beginner's omission as the game's jargon is voluminous. There could have been a List of Tables too. And these tables could have had summaries or group breakouts so that the many character(s)(istics) are better organized. The screen shots could be larger and less dark. I bought it at a local used bookstore and the game at a garage sale. Of course, certain key subjects and data tables had erroneous or omitted information.

Each game is saved in the game folder as single_X.SV, where X is 0 to 9; ten games max. Thus create a historical archive subfolder and keep old and partially played games there. Second, game files vary from 200KB to 3MB. So burn game files onto a CD, email, or save on a Zip to impress friends and foes. Finally, do judicious saving for replaying level(s) that eventually went sour. Use the keyboard Ctrl+Alt+Esc to toggle to Windows for making notes and performing file maintenance.

To win maximize building experience points and accumulating gold and key special weapons. Finding, identifying, and redeeming EVERY single weapon, armor, chest, scroll, staff, book, ring, tomb, library, and shrine on every level to maximize your power. Often the first 5 levels and what you accumulate therein can give you a premonition on the final outcome of the game.

For example, the Sorcerer is quite vulnerable in the beginning and the player must strive to play almost perfect levels. Waste the least amount of resources on the minions and don't let them touch you. Learn to run away and lead them into a trap. Accumulate and convert your operating weapons and armor from standard to special ones. Sell as many of the std weapons for health, mana, and ID scrolls from Adria, the Witch. Buy ID scrolls from her as much as possible compared to paying Cain to ID. Categorize the specials and unique weapons and armor into red and blue (fire and lightning resistant), in rows on the ground so that best combinations can be easily selected. Run a pre-level scouting expedition to find what's new on each level. Return to town near the beginning of each level and always re-visit Adria. Apparently attacking minions on a new level triggers her to provide a new list of scrolls, books, and staffs. Accumulate and deploy key fire, lightning, and mana shield spell books rapidly, compared to duplicative staffs and scrolls which are redeemed for more gold. Spell books, and their cumulative power from multiple units, will affect later quest outcomes. If it is taking too much to finish off a minion; its probably because you are doing it wrong. Finally, Quests do not have to be completed serially; do the first five levels without doing the Butcher and King Leoric. Then when stronger and with Arkaine's Valor armor, return back and efficiently finish off the buzzards. Use fKey to Holy Bolt for dealing with skeletons, zombies, King Leoric, and finally Diablo.

Diablo doesn't lend itself to easy answers. Random changes with each new game assure a new experience each time, so to win, you need a mastery of the constants you can rely on. As useful as the book's general tips are, its greatest advantage is in the pages and pages of charts comparing the traits of monsters, spells, weapons, armor, and much more. Rather than giving away how to win, this guide gives you the info you need to make your own wise choices. A special section covers additional information for the real-time Net version of the game.

...Warning! This guide will be of use to those who only want a very general overview of the new Druid and Assassin character classes.... HOWEVER, the rest of the book is hopelesss outdated, seeing as it was written for the 1.07 version of D2 and the game is currently in its 1.09d patch...with promises of another ( 1.10 version ) patch sometime in June/July of 2002. This guide went in the trash when Blizzard released their 1.08 patch a mere three weeks into LoD's public release. Since then everything has changed vastly. Character skills have been altered so the tables are totally wrong. Sets and Uniques....well just about all of them have been changed, some beyond recognition. For example the unique round shield orginally a + skills necro item is now a sorcess skills item with total different mod's. As for the unique Archon staff ( an elite weapon), well it no longer exsists; instead it's name has been assigned to the unique Giant Thresher, which has totally different mod's and is used by a totally diffent kind of character! Most of the Runewords and Crafted items spells ( advertized as new for LoD ) have either been blocked or changed... about 90% of them weren't even in the guide to begin with! Just about everything is changed so completely that this guide would have to be TOTALLY rewritten ( perferably by someone who has actually played the game, not just read the fact sheets Blizzard passed down to them ). Even nearly a year later I see this guide in various stores and have to warn off people who want to get it... Don't get me wrong, LoD is a great game to try ( I play about 20-25 hrs per week on Realms ), but this guide is very outdated. Hopefully, someone will wake up at Brady and rewrite this book so it reflects the true picture of what D2LoD is now like on the Realms. As an avid Diablo 2 fan I have anxiously awaited this new release in the Diablo storyline modules. The description of the product as covering the entire Diablo 2 game from Act One to Act Four merely wetted my appetite for more. Imagine my dissappointment to find a product containing poor guidelines for encounter levels, recycled artwork, pages of filler (repeated monster descriptions from Diablo 2: Diablerie,) and typos so obvious you would think that this was rushed into production and not seen by a proofreader. Any adventure whose pricetag is 50% higher than the price of the core books should be stunning in content and form, presented without errors, and be clear in the descriptions of game mechanics. I have only the highest praise for all the changes made to the new edition of the rules. The sliding exp scale, rewritten character classes, and the smoother combat all add to the enjoyment I and my players experience in our weekly sessions. The first Diablo adventure had us playing 8 hour marathon sessions each night for almost 2 weeks. Perhaps my expectations were too high for this product, but it is disappointing in falling short of the standards I have seen in other books recently. I am sure that any inconsistancies in the rules contained in the product will be brought up in a forum either on the web site or in Dragon Magazine, however nothing can take away from the flow of a session as greatly as a player stating "... but I read online that ..."

Those who love the single-player version of Diablo have often grown ecstatic over the online multiplayer Battle.net version. Mark Walker's guide will help you get the most from your playing time whether you're in for a couple hours or the whole weekend. He assumes you already know the game's basics from the single-player version and concentrates on the strategic elements of team play--including such matters as how to avoid those players who delight in killing off other players. A nearly 60- page appendix is filled with charts, tables, and resources to help you best plan your campaign.
